End of Support for Windows 10
As of October 13, 2025, Microsoft will no longer support Windows 10. After the end of support, no updates will be provided for this product, even if new security issues are discovered. We would like to inform you of the following information so that you can continue to use your computers safely.
-
Software Version Upgrade
Due to increased security risks, we strongly recommend that you upgrade your OS if you are using Windows 10. Before upgrading, please make sure that your PC meets the minimum requirements.
